As nouns the difference between clarity and indecision

is that clarity is the state, or measure of being clear, either in appearance, thought or style; lucidity while indecision is indecision, quandary.

    indecision

    English

    Noun

    (en-noun)
  • The inability to decide on a course of action, especially if two or more possibilities exist.
  • * 1903 , , chapter 21:
  • There was no indecision or delay in the establishment of their relations; Rebecca's heart flew like an arrow to its mark, and her mind, meeting its superior, settled at once into an abiding attitude of respectful homage.
